This position is listed on behalf of a partner company, who manages all applications and next steps. Our partner is looking for a Quality & Performance Assurance Director, Client Service & Operations - Evernorth based in United States.
This senior leadership role will drive the modernization of a complex, enterprise-wide quality and performance assurance function. You will evolve quality management from traditional inspection and audit activities into a risk-aligned, data-driven capability that strengthens operational integrity and business performance. The role partners closely with operational risk, controls, compliance, client operations, and enablement teams to create scalable governance and continuous improvement practices. You will leverage automation, AI-enabled capabilities, and digital workflows to improve quality effectiveness and operational insight. The position also provides strategic guidance to senior leaders on risk exposure, performance trends, and operational readiness. This is an opportunity to lead meaningful transformation while building a high-performing quality organization focused on innovation, accountability, and measurable results.
